Comprehending the Types of Drills
Before diving into the affordability element, it's important to comprehend the different types of drills offered. Here's a quick introduction:
| Type of Drill | Description | Price Range |
|---|---|---|
| Corded Drill | Supplies continuous power, perfect for heavy-duty jobs. | ₤ 40 - ₤ 100 |
| Cordless Drill | Battery-operated, portable, and versatile for different jobs. | ₤ 30 - ₤ 150 |
| Hammer Drill | Combines rotary movement with a hammering action for masonry work. | ₤ 50 - ₤ 200 |
| Impact Driver | Delivers high torque for driving screws into tough products. | ₤ 60 - ₤ 250 |
| Rotary Drill | A specific drill for particular jobs, such as jewelry making. | ₤ 50 - ₤ 150 |
Expedition of Corded vs. Cordless Drills
Among the loudest debates among DIYers revolves around the option between corded and cordless drills. Here's a more detailed examination:
Corded Drills:
- Pros: Unlimited power supply; usually lighter and often cheaper.
- Cons: Limited movement; requires to be plugged in.
Cordless Drills:
- Pros: Portable; flexible working angles due to the rechargeable battery.
- Cons: Limited battery life; can be much heavier since of battery weight.
The Essential Features of an Affordable Drill
When searching for an affordable drill, certain functions can greatly enhance usability and performance. Here's a list of essential functions:
- Variable Speed Settings: Allows better control when drilling into different products.
- Adjustable Clutch: Prevents overtightening and assists handle torque, particularly helpful for driving screws.
- Ergonomic Design: A comfy grip reduces pressure throughout extended usage.
- Battery Longevity: For cordless drills, a lasting battery is essential for uninterrupted work.
- Chuck Size: A standard 1/2 inch chuck is versatile for different bits, while smaller sized sizes might limit performance.
- Weight and Size: Lightweight models are typically more manageable and lower user tiredness.
These features differ extensively in price, however important performances often come at an incredible value even in affordable designs.
Setting a Budget for Your Drill
Understanding how much you want to spend can determine choices considerably. Below is a breakdown of budget categories and what you can anticipate in each range:
| Price Range | Expected Features |
|---|---|
| ₤ 30 - ₤ 50 | Standard functionality, lower torque power; ideal for light usage. |
| ₤ 50 - ₤ 100 | Helpful for occasional users; consists of variable speed settings. |
| ₤ 100 - ₤ 150 | Moderate to advanced functions; drills efficient in much heavier jobs. |
| ₤ 150+ | Professional-grade tools with high performance and toughness. |
